NBC Securities Inc. Increases Stock Holdings in PepsiCo, Inc. (NASDAQ:PEP)

PepsiCo logo with Consumer Staples background

NBC Securities Inc. grew its position in shares of PepsiCo, Inc. (NASDAQ:PEP - Free Report) by 111,652.0% during the 1st quarter, according to its most recent fil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The firm owned 27,938 shares of the company's stock after buying an additional 27,913 shares during the period. NBC Securities Inc.'s holdings in PepsiCo were worth $4,189,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

PepsiCo Increases Dividend

The company also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Monday, June 30th. Stockholders of record on Friday, June 6th will be issued a dividend of $1.4225 per share. This is an increase from PepsiCo's previous quarterly dividend of $1.36. The ex-dividend date of this dividend is Friday, June 6th. This represents a $5.69 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 4.34%. PepsiCo's payout ratio is currently 83.68%.

PepsiCo Profile

(Free Report)

PepsiCo, Inc engages in the manufacture, marketing, distribution, and sale of various beverages and convenient foods worldwide. The company operates through seven segments: Frito-Lay North America; Quaker Foods North America; PepsiCo Beverages North America; Latin America; Europe; Africa, Middle East and South Asia; and Asia Pacific, Australia and New Zealand and China Region.
